DESCRIPTION

The Safety Coordinator is responsible for developing, implementing and updating HSE written plans, safe work practices / procedures, hazard assessments and other HSE related documentation as required. Responsibilities also include facilitating HSE related training (including orientation, supervisory training). Responsibilities may also include the completion of tracking, trending and reporting internal and externally (client and government) This position will be based out of our Woodfibre Tunnel Project office in Squamish, BC.

REQUIREMENTS

  • Degree or diploma in a related field i.e. HSE or OH&S.
  • 5-7 years’ experience in construction safety standards and practices in major construction projects.
  • Must have minimum of 2 years experience working on projects related to tunneling.
  • Must possess a valid driver license for the type(s) of vehicles which may be driven, and an acceptable driving record as determined by Michels Review Team.

DESIRED SKILLS/QUALIFICATIONS

  • CRSP certified (Canadian Registered Safety Professional) or similar designation is considered an asset.
  • Experience working on joint venture projects is an asset.

Responsibilities:

  • Maintain and promote a strong safety culture for all employees, subcontractors, vendors, and customers and follow all safety policies, procedures, and regulations. Identify and communicate workplace hazards and correct or seek assistance in correcting unsafe actions or conditions.
    Administer and update the site-specific Safety Plan, Emergency Response Plan Project Hazard Assessment, Job Hazard Assessments as project conditions change.

  • Advise and assist with the development of orientation, onboarding, training and competency programs and processes.


    • Onboard and mentor all new and existing employees with health, safety and environmental responsibilities and expectations. Build strong relationships with Operations, work closely with them to ensure the HSE Program aligns with the work that is being completed.

      Provide work instruction/training as required (e.g., WHMIS, TDG, Confined space, PPE), use and care of specialized personal protective equipment (ie. respiratory, fall protection etc.).



      • Identify best practices and lead continuous improvement initiatives to reduce risks, raise safety awareness, and improve safe work practices.

      • Make available to workers the applicable health and safety acts, regulations, codes, ensure all applicable safe work procedures are available to workers and followed on site.
      • Uphold company culture and core values by adhering to Michels Canada’s Standards and Policies and working with others to promote and preserve our values while conducting your duties to contribute to a positive and professional work environment.
      • Build strong relationships and maintain them with the client throughout the life of the project.
